//! If you're on a Unix system, try something like:
//!
//! `yes | cargo run --example count_keys`
//!
//! (Originally from
//! https://github.com/paulkernfeld/tokio-stdin/blob/master/examples/count_keys.rs)
extern crate futures;
extern crate tokio_stdin;
extern crate tokio_timer;
use futures::stream::Stream;
use futures::stream;
use std::time::Duration;
use tokio_stdin::spawn_stdin_stream_unbounded;
use tokio_timer::{Timer, TimerError};
#[derive(Debug)]
enum Error {
Timer(TimerError),
Stdin(()),
}
#[derive(Debug)]
enum Event {
Byte,
Second,
}
fn main() {
let seconds_stream = Timer::default()
.interval(Duration::from_secs(1))
.map(|()| Some(Event::Second))
.map_err(Error::Timer);
let stdin_stream = spawn_stdin_stream_unbounded()
.map(|_| Some(Event::Byte))
.map_err(Error::Stdin)
.chain(stream::iter_result(vec![Ok(None)]));
let mut n_bytes = 0;
let mut n_seconds = 0;
let mut exit = false;
let rate = seconds_stream.select(stdin_stream);
for event in rate.wait() {
match event {
Ok(Some(Event::Byte)) => {
n_bytes += 1;
}
Ok(Some(Event::Second)) => {
n_seconds += 1;
println!("{} bytes in {} seconds", n_bytes, n_seconds);
if exit { return; }
}
Ok(None) => {
println!("stdin closed");
exit = true;
}
Err(e) => eprintln!("error {:?}", e),
}
}
}
